>> Forgive if this is such a simple question but I have little
>> experience with pixmaps and how they are handled in fvwm.
>>
>> I have this deco:
>>
>>
>>
>> DestroyDecor Decoration
>> AddToDecor Decoration
>> + ButtonStyle All -- UseTitleStyle Flat
>> + BorderStyle Active Colorset 2 -- HiddenHandles NoInset
>> + BorderStyle Inactive Colorset 1 -- HiddenHandles NoInset
>> + ButtonStyle 7 Pixmap application-exit.png -- Flat
>> + TitleStyle Active Colorset 2
>> + TitleStyle Inactive Colorset 1
>> + TitleStyle Height 32 -- Flat
>>
>>
>> application-exit.png has some transparent parts, and besides that, it's
>> a 22x22 image, so there's a lot of room around it. I've set all the
>> buttons to use the title style. However instead I see the default grey
>> color around the pixmap. Is there a way to overcome that without
>> resizing the image to fit the whole height of the title bar?
>
> Have you not looked at using AdjustedPixmap?  If that's not reliable,
> just adjust the PNG file to fit the size you want.

Thanks, Thomas,

Yes, I've tried, but in the places where the png is transparent
(square icons are rare nowadays) I can still see the grey color.
Not a big deal, this is easy to automate using imagemagick, but
I was just wondering if fvwm was capable of this not to reinvent
the wheel.
